5. Corrosion Resistance
Stainless steel’s composition includes chromium, which provides excellent corrosion resistance. When shopping for flatware, you’ll notice numbers like 18/10, 18/8, and 18/0, which indicate the percentage of chromium and nickel in the alloy. We recommend choosing 18/10 or 18/8 stainless steel flatware, as these grades offer the best resistance to corrosion and maintain their shine over time. Avoid 18/0 stainless steel flatware, as it lacks nickel, making it more susceptible to scratches and corrosion.
